Pokemon Champions unlikely to get offline single player mode

· My Nintendo News

Many people seem to be enjoying Pokemon Champions and the ability to play against other skilled users, however there are some that wouldn’t mind an offline single player mode. VGC chatted with Masaaki Hoshino, the director of Pokémon Champions, to discuss a range of topics and one of those echoed was the possibility of an offline mode being added in the future. Hoshino said that’s a difficult one as adding single player modes would “move people away from the PvP.” He doesn’t completely rule it out, but says that he wants “to focus on PvP for the time being.”

“For the time being, we probably won’t be adding additional modes similar to Pokémon Stadium,” Hoshino answers.

“The reason is if you start adding a lot of single-player modes, that kind of moves people away from the PvP, and that actually increases the match time, which makes it a little more difficult for a PvP game. So at least while more people are increasingly playing, I want to focus on PvP for the time being.”
